Mission Statement

The mission of Avenue Scholars Foundation (ASF) is to ensure careers for committed students of hope and need through education/training and supportive relationships.

Background

ASF provides comprehensive, individualized support and resources to help students from low-income families identify, persist toward, and enter financially sustaining careers. Students are selected based on financial need (eligibility for free or reduced-priced school lunches, or a federal Pell grant) and interest in pursuing a career requiring an associate degree or less in one of the following high-demand industry sectors: 1) health care, 2) information technology, 3) automotive technology/transportation, 4) trades/manufacturing/builders, and 5) business/office processes.

Brag Lines

ASF has supported the career development of 2,106 students since its inception in 2008. Thanks to the generosity of the Suzanne and Walter Scott Foundation, and the ongoing support of Metropolitan Community College, ASF recently added direct scholarship assistance to the relationship-based support services provided by its dedicated staff. Beginning this past spring, all students who successfully complete ASF’s high school program will receive an $8,000 scholarship to continue their education/training at MCC.
